What is Octordle?
A Brief Overview
Octordle is an online word game inspired by Wordle, but with a major twist: instead of guessing one five-letter word, players must solve eight five-letter words at the same time. You have 13 tries to guess all eight words, making it a much more complex and brain-teasing experience.
Who Created Octordle?
The game was created by Kenneth Crawford in early 2022. Inspired by the global success of Wordle, Crawford wanted to design a version that would offer a tougher challenge for hardcore puzzle lovers. Octordle quickly caught on and built a passionate fan base.
How to Play Octordle
The Basic Rules
- You have 13 attempts to correctly guess eight five-letter words.
- Each guess is applied to all eight words simultaneously.
- After each guess, the letters light up:
- Green means the letter is in the correct spot.
- Yellow means the letter is in the word but in the wrong spot.
- Gray means the letter is not in the word at all.
The ultimate goal is to solve all eight puzzles before running out of guesses.
Differences from Wordle
While Wordle focuses on a single five-letter word with six guesses, Octordle demands that players manage eight different puzzles at once. This adds layers of strategy, memory, and multi-tasking to the gameplay.

Strategies for Winning Octordle
Start with Strong Opening Words
Like in Wordle, it’s smart to start with a word that uses common vowels and consonants. Good starting words include:
- ADIEU
- CRANE
- AUDIO
- SLATE
These words cover a lot of the alphabet and help you gather early clues.
Focus on Solving Easier Words First
Some boards will reveal words more quickly than others. Solve the easier words first to reduce the number of puzzles you’re tracking simultaneously.
Use Previous Guesses to Your Advantage
Each guess gives feedback across all eight boards. Pay close attention to patterns and letters that pop up on multiple puzzles.
Keep Track of Letters Used
Since you are dealing with eight puzzles at once, it’s easy to forget which letters you’ve already confirmed. Make a mental note or even jot them down on paper if necessary.
Stay Calm and Think Ahead
Patience is key. Don’t rush. Take your time to plan your guesses strategically to maximize efficiency across all eight boards.
Variations of Octordle
Daily Octordle
The most popular mode, where everyone around the world works on the same set of words for the day.
Free Play Mode
For those who can’t get enough, there’s a free play mode allowing unlimited practice puzzles.
Other Variants: Dordle, Quordle, Sedecordle
Octordle isn’t alone in expanding the Wordle formula:
- Dordle: Solve two words simultaneously.
- Quordle: Solve four words.
- Sedecordle: Solve a whopping sixteen words!
Each variation adds a different level of difficulty and excitement.

Common Challenges Players Face
Overwhelming Number of Boards
At first, the idea of solving eight puzzles at once can feel overwhelming. But with practice, players become more comfortable managing the chaos.
Limited Guesses
Thirteen guesses may seem like a lot — until you realize how fast they disappear when juggling eight words. Careful and smart guessing is crucial.
Similar Words
Words that share similar letters or patterns (like “plate” and “place”) can confuse even experienced players.
